Press Release

FOR IMMEDIATE RELEASE:

Wednesday, December 02, 2004, 9 A.M.

SUBJECT:

Sutter Sheriff Deputies requesting information regarding attack on Yuba City woman

TEXT:

Sutter County Sheriff’s Deputies are requesting information from the public regarding an attack on an East Indian female that occurred on Nov 04, 2004 while she was attending a meeting at the Sikh Temple on Tierra Buena Road.  The 46 year old Yuba City woman was injured as she was leaving the temple as a result of being hit by a male subject wielding a shovel.  Just prior to this, a confrontation occurred as a group of meeting goers were attempting to leave the temple and were confronted by several individuals armed with shovels and broom sticks.  The altercation involved approximately 25-50 individuals. 

Sheriff’s Deputies are asking that anyone with information regarding the incident or anyone who may have video taped the incident to contact the Sutter County Sheriff’s Detective Division at (530) 822-7313.
